Chapter 114: My light in the darkness. Yao Jun continued to slowly feed Guo Luo various herbs to slow down the spread of the poison. After spending nearly five hours slowly feeding her medicine and making sure that the spread of the poison had almost completely stopped, he finally heaved a sigh of relief. He was not capable of forcing the poison out of her body, but he had at least made sure that the poison had almost stopped spreading. As it was now, it had covered her entire right arm and parts of her right chest. The poison had yet to reach any of her vital organs, allowing Yao Jun to breathe another sigh of relief. “Don't worry Luo'er, i'll get the antidote shortly.” Yao Jun gently removed Guo Luo's head from his lap and stroked her hair a bit more. Her entire face was pale and covered in cold sweat, despite her having lost her consciousness, her eyebrows were still furrowed in pain. After making sure that Guo Luo was temporarily safe, Yao Jun left the gate and stepped onto Little Gray's back. Yao Jun sat down on Little Gray's back, his left leg outstretched while he used his right knee to prop up his right arm. “Full speed Little Gray. I want to be there as fast as possible.” As Yao Jun spoke, his armor and sword appeared on his body, shielding him from the whipping winds that Little Gray's full speed produced. Yao Jun's eyes were firmly locked onto the distance, locked on where Raging Snow City was. As he sat on the back of Little Gray, he could feel the power of his gate pulsating through his body, channeling faster than it ever had before, even his armor seemed to pulsate slightly. Yao Jun had sensed this sensation once before, back when Guo Luo had been attacked while he was unconscious. Already back then, Yao Jun had an idea about what the reason behind it could be, but now his thoughts had been confirmed. Sword Empyrean Heng Jiang had told Yao Jun that he must never let himself be controlled by his emotions, especially rage. Back then, Yao Jun thought that this meant that he must try to restrain his anger and choke it down. But he was wrong. Others might be able to do this, but if Yao Jun did it, it would harm him. He held the Demon God's Gate, the power of a demon god. Rage would never harm the demon god, it would only aid him, granting him the strength to destroy all that would anger him. Yao Jun must never let himself be controlled by his rage, but neither must he smother it. He had to control his rage, instead of letting it blaze like an inferno, he had to let it freeze and turn into a glacier. Once he learnt to properly control his rage, he could use it like a weapon to strengthen himself and slay his opponents. With these thoughts in mind, Yao Jun closed his eyes and started to calm his breathing. Even at Little Gray's full speed, it would take around two days to reach Raging Snow City. This meant that he had to take this chance to calm down and make sure that he was at his peak condition. After a little over two days of constant flight, Yao Jun opened his eyes and gazed upon Raging Snow City. His gray eyes held not a single trace of rage, they were almost completely empty, his state of mind impossible to read from them. Looking into them was like trying to stare into the depths of a gray fog. Raging Snow City was much larger than Winter Wind Town, but they had the same style of architecture. The entire city was currently very lively, with lit lanterns in a myriad of colors decorating every street and house. At the very center of the city stood a massive mansion that covered a few kilometers of land. The mansion was not made out of the same wood as the rest of the city, but was built out of the same hardened blocks of snow that Snow's Heart Town was made out of. Yao Jun could see a large courtyard located at the front of the mansion. The courtyard was filled with a large amount of tables, each table seating several people. There was one table sitting at the very front, which only had two people on it, this was clearly the table of the Raging Snow Monarch. “Go.” Yao Jun calmly spoke a single word, and Little Gray let out a loud screech that resounded over the entire city. He shot forward, appearing above the large courtyard in only a few seconds. Upon hearing the screech, everyone in the courtyard had turned their head to the sky in curiosity. Seeing the large gray eagle appear above the courtyard, most of the people in the courtyard didn't have too much of a reaction. But the people from the Raging Snow Sect reacted strongly upon seeing the gray eagle, their faces turning gloomy. “Where is Cui Dong?” Yao Jun had Little Gray fly closer to the ground, before he stood up and calmly looked at everyone in the courtyard. His eyes ended up turning towards a thin middle aged man with pale skin. He had long white hair and was clad in an extravagant robe that featured the insignia of the Raging Snow Sect embroidered on the entire chest. This person was at the late stage of the 2nd Mortal Earth, so it was clear that he was Cui Bao. Standing next to him was a male who seemed to be around 30 years old. The male had short purple hair and was clad in the same robe as Cui Bao. This person was at the early stage of the 2nd Mortal Earth, so he was most likely Cui Dong. “You must be brother Jun. Why don't you give old me some face and come down and join us in this celebration? Surely there is no need for us to be hostile just because of a single maid. If we just sit down and have a chat, I am sure that we will realize that working together is better than being enemies.” Contrary to what Yao Jun expected, Cui Bao stood up and cupped his hands toward Yao Jun, speaking in a friendly tone. While he looked friendly, Cui Bao was silently cursing the people who had failed to kill Yao Jun. He had already gotten the news that Yao Jun and his friends had managed to kill Li Quan back on the Yang continent. Of course, they did that as a group, but Cui Bao still slightly feared Yao Jun's power, as he did not know just how strong he was. What made Cui Bao feel like cursing even more was that not only had they failed to kill Yao Jun, they hadn't even managed to die without handing over information. Since Yao Jun came here and immediately called for Cui Dong, it was clear that he probably knew everything. “Face? Fuck your face. And how dare you talk about my Luo'er like that?” Yao Jun's voice turned cold upon hearing Cui Bao's words. He hopped down from the back of Little Gray, landing on a table filled with food and crushing it. He took a step closer towards Cui Bao, Little Gray circling overhead, overlooking everything with a vigilant gaze. “While I was trapped in a darkness that your Guo clan placed me in, I saw a tiny ray of light. It was just a tiny thing, just the smallest mote of light. Yet I found that it shone ever so brightly in the darkness, capable of completely shielding me from the darkness.” “So I clung to it, I clung to it with all my might and refused to let go. And I found that no matter how drenched in the smell of blood and death I became covered in, that ray of light just started shining brighter, always at my side, always keeping the darkness at bay. You tried to remove that ray of light from my side and now you have the gall to ask me to give you face?” Yao Jun's expression had turned ice cold as he finished his words, his killing intent almost turning tangible.
